プログラミング学習の
ナレッジベース

現役エンジニアが実践で得た知見や、プログラミング学習のノウハウを詳しく解説。 初学者から中級者まで、スキルアップに役立つ情報を提供しています。

すべての記事

【Python YAML】初心者向けにYAMLファイルの読み書きや活用方法を徹底解説

PythonでYAMLファイルを扱う方法を、初心者向けに具体的なコード例とともにわかりやすく解説します。YAMLの基本構文や実務での活用シーン、Pythonとの組み合わせによるデータ読み込みや書き込みのメリットを学べます。初心者でも理解しやすいステップで、実用的な情報をまとめています。

Python

GitLab Runnerを使ったCI/CD入門|初心者向けにわかりやすく解説

GitLab Runnerを用いたCI/CDの基本的な考え方や導入手順を初心者向けにわかりやすく解説します。具体的な設定例や実務での活用シーンを交えて、開発を効率化するポイントをお伝えします。

Git

【JavaScript】全角 半角 変換とは?初心者向けにわかりやすく解説

JavaScriptで文字列の全角と半角を変換する方法を初めて学ぶ方にも理解しやすく紹介します。実務での活用ポイントや具体的なコード例も交えてわかりやすく解説します。

JavaScript

【Git】ブランチはどう使えばいい?ブランチ戦略を初心者向けにわかりやすく解説

gitのブランチ戦略とは何か、実務でどのように活用されるのかを具体例とともに初心者向けに解説します。メリットや注意点を理解し、チーム開発を円滑に進めるための基礎を身につけましょう。

Git

インフラエンジニアとは?仕事内容・必要スキル・将来性をわかりやすく解説

インフラエンジニアとは、サーバーやネットワークなどIT基盤を支える重要な役割です。本記事ではその定義や仕事内容、求められるスキル、将来性、未経験からのステップなどをわかりやすく解説します。

AWSAzureGoogle Cloud

【Git】git clone ブランチ指定で狙ったブランチをコピーする方法をわかりやすく解説

Gitでブランチを指定してリポジトリをクローンする方法を初心者にもわかりやすく解説します。実務でも活用しやすい具体例を交えながら、関連コマンドやトラブルシューティングについても詳しく紹介します。

Git

【JavaScript】配列の初期化とは?基本的な書き方から便利な初期化パターンまで初心者向けに解説

JavaScriptの配列の初期化方法を初心者向けに丁寧に解説します。配列リテラルやArrayコンストラクタ、スプレッド構文を使った応用例など幅広く紹介。実務でよく使われるシーンやパターンも多数のコード例をもとにわかりやすく説明します。

JavaScript

【JavaScript】ループと配列とは?基本的な使い方を初心者向けにわかりやすく解説

JavaScriptのループと配列について、基本的な概念から実装パターン、実務での活用シーンまで初心者でもわかりやすく解説します。for文やwhile文、配列操作など実用例を多数紹介します。

JavaScript

WordPress PHP バージョンを正しく理解してトラブルを減らす方法

WordPressを運用するうえで欠かせないPHPバージョンの基本をわかりやすく解説します。バージョン選択のポイントや確認方法、実務での具体的な活用シーンなどを紹介し、初心者でも安全に運用できる知識を身につけましょう。

WordPressPHP

CIDRとは?IPv4やIPv6のアドレス管理とネットワーク設計への活用

CIDR(Classless Inter-Domain Routing)とは何かを初心者にもわかりやすく解説します。ネットワーク設計やIPアドレス管理における役割、実務での具体的な活用シーン、便利なコマンドの活用例などを紹介します。

Python

【Python】メソッドの一覧と使い方を初心者向けに解説

Pythonでよく使われるメソッドの一覧と使い方を初心者向けにわかりやすく解説します。文字列操作やリスト、辞書、集合などの基本から実務での活用例まで網羅するので、Python メソッド 一覧を探している方にとって学習の一助となる内容です。

Python

Unreal Engine C++とは?初心者にもわかりやすいポイントを解説

Unreal Engine C++とは何か、初心者でもわかりやすい形で解説します。ゲーム開発に欠かせないC++とUnreal Engineの連携を基礎から紹介し、実務での具体的な利用シーンや基本的なコード例を紹介します。

C++Unreal Engine

GitHub とは?初心者が知っておきたい活用シーンを解説

GitHub とは何か、初心者でもわかるように解説します。Gitとの連携やプルリクエストの流れを具体的な例とともに紹介し、実務での活用方法をわかりやすくまとめます。

Git

LLM(大規模言語モデル)を無料で使うには?初心者にもわかりやすく解説

LLM(大規模言語モデル)を無料で使う基本的な方法や応用例を初心者向けに説明します。具体的なプログラミング例と実務シーンでの活用術を詳しく解説。

PythonOpenAI APIHugging Face

【JavaScript】URLとは?基本的な使い方と実践例を初心者向けにわかりやすく解説

JavaScriptのURL機能を中心に、初心者でも理解しやすい形で基本操作から応用的な活用例まで解説します。URLオブジェクトやURLSearchParamsを使った具体的な実務シーンに役立つサンプルコードも紹介します。

JavaScript

【Python】プログラム終了の方法を初心者向けに解説

Pythonでプログラムを終了するさまざまな方法を、初心者向けにわかりやすく解説します。実践的なシーンに即したコード例を交えながら、スクリプト終了時に行うべき処理のポイントや、exit()とsys.exit()の使い分けなどを丁寧に紹介します。

Python

【Python】オーバーライドとは?初心者向けに具体例つきでわかりやすく解説

Pythonのオーバーライドの基本原理や使い方を初心者向けに解説します。クラスを継承する際に使われるメソッドのオーバーライドとは何か、具体的なコード例、実務での活用シーン、注意点などを整理しました。これからPythonでオブジェクト指向プログラミングを学ぶ方にも役立つ内容です。

Python

機械学習エンジニアとは?仕事内容・必要スキル・将来性を徹底解説

機械学習エンジニアの役割や必要スキル、将来性について初心者向けにわかりやすく解説します。実務での活用シーンから求人動向、年収まで詳しく紹介します。

PythonTensorFlowPyTorch